As you may or may not know, today marks the start of three days of festivities for the Chinese world in Chinese New Year :) Traditionally, this is where us younglings go to our elders to 年 (bai leen), and whole families gather together in their homes for communal meals and so forth.

CNY also gives us an excuse to eat chocolate straight after you've woken up (I just had a Picnic bar lol). You also literally feel like you're financially secure at the prospect of receiving 利市 (lai see) - which are red paper envelopes usually filled with $20 notes in Hong Kong - from everyone :P Alongside this, grandoise firework shows and parades often take place, whether they're around the city (as is the case in Hong Kong) or in your local Chinatowns (if you have any).

So 恭禧發財 (gong hei faat choi), 身体健康 (sun tai geen hong), 学习进步 (hok yeep jun bo), 心想事成 (sum seung si sing) and have a wonderful year of the monkey :)
